The global sections of the chiral de Rham complex on a Kummer surface
Abstract
The chiral de Rham complex is a sheaf of vertex algebras chM on any nonsingular algebraic variety or complex manifold M, which contains the ordinary de Rham complex as the weight zero subspace. We show that when M is a Kummer surface, the algebra of global sections is isomorphic to the N = 4 superconformal vertex algebra with central charge 6. Previously, CPn was the only manifold where a complete description of the global section algebra was known.
